Transaction 1e20904804954c7589a4778b36d58d362c7a34d7b7b3b057d641a50012521dae
1 Input
2 Outputs
- 1e20904804954c7589a4778b36d58d362c7a34d7b7b3b057d641a50012521dae:0
- 1e20904804954c7589a4778b36d58d362c7a34d7b7b3b057d641a50012521dae:1
value 25943724
address 16Rfaoo31LygPBEuzpLm2VQbAgXeUZ9k8h
value 1988234
address 1M3Zy2xrHqrb2JV3LE7rtcxkk6xVt69NWG